> If an ISO is attached to a running VM, and you delete that ISO via CloudStack, the ISO file is deleted from secondary storage. However, it is left attached to the running VM, and it cannot be detached while the VM is running. The exception given in the log is pasted below (full snippet attached). It appears that CloudStack is not even trying to detach it (no tasks show up on vSphere). 
> Shutting down the VM and detaching the ISO works fine, but this is an inconvenience at the least and should be handled better. For example, ISO deletion could fail if it is attached to any VM, ISOs could be automatically detached from VMs before being deleted, or deleted ISOs could be detachable from running VMs.
